Sun Nov 17 13:58:36 UTC 2024: ## Kuruva Gang Suspects Arrested for Alappuzha Thefts

**Alappuzha, Kerala – November 17, 2024** – Two men, identified as Santhosh Selvam and Manikandan, both Tamil Nadu natives, have been arrested in connection with a series of thefts in Mannancherry, Alappuzha, on October 29th. Police confirmed the suspects are linked to the notorious Kuruva gang.

Santhosh, who briefly escaped police custody, was recaptured and brought to Mannancherry on Sunday for evidence collection. Alappuzha Deputy Superintendent of Police M.R. Madhu Babu stated that Santhosh has confessed to involvement in approximately 30 thefts across various locations and is linked to eight cases in Kerala alone. He confirmed that Santhosh is a member of a 12-14 person Kuruva gang currently operating in Kerala. Further arrests are anticipated.

While Manikandan’s arrest has yet to be officially recorded, police are investigating the potential involvement of a group of women who protested at the Mannancherry police station, claiming the men were wrongly accused. The police dismissed these claims and stated that the women’s role in the thefts is also under investigation. The investigation continues.
